草庐IT

insertion-sort

全部标签

linux - 如何使用 'sort' 按第一列文本排序,然后按第二列数字排序?

我正在尝试对以下文件进行排序:a2b1a10我需要得到:a2a10b1我知道-kPOS[opts]选项,并尝试使用它:sort-k1-k2nfile但是这个命令只给我:a10a2b1因此它按第一列排序,但不按第二列排序。仅运行sort-k2nfile按第二列排序。b1a2a10如何按两列对它进行排序?编辑:排序(GNU核心实用程序)5.93 最佳答案 您必须终止主键,否则,排序将使用从给定字段开始的所有字段:sort-k1,1-k2n 关于linux-如何使用'sort'按第一列文本排序

linux - 如何使用内置的 "sort"程序同时按两个字段(一个数字,一个字符串)排序?

我有一个文件,比方说“大文件”,其中包含以下形式的表格数据,a1b2a31b1a2c30...等等。我想在我的Linux机器上使用内置的“排序”程序,所以按第四个字段(数字)然后同时按第一个字段对这个文件进行排序。我浏览了几次手册页,我所能想到的就是,sort-n-k4,4-k1,1bigfile有没有办法让“排序”按照我的意愿进行,或者我必须编写自己的自定义程序?谢谢。 最佳答案 来自手册页:POSisF[.C][OPTS],whereFisthefieldnumberandCthecharacterpositioninthefi

linux - 如何使用内置的 "sort"程序同时按两个字段(一个数字,一个字符串)排序?

我有一个文件,比方说“大文件”,其中包含以下形式的表格数据,a1b2a31b1a2c30...等等。我想在我的Linux机器上使用内置的“排序”程序,所以按第四个字段(数字)然后同时按第一个字段对这个文件进行排序。我浏览了几次手册页,我所能想到的就是,sort-n-k4,4-k1,1bigfile有没有办法让“排序”按照我的意愿进行,或者我必须编写自己的自定义程序?谢谢。 最佳答案 来自手册页:POSisF[.C][OPTS],whereFisthefieldnumberandCthecharacterpositioninthefi

linux - 如何使用 Linux 命令 Sort 根据第 4 列,数字顺序对文本文件进行排序?

我有一个这样的文件(以空格分隔):AX-18Chr1_419085141908545TC-1980.51AX-19Chr1_419087141908740TC0150.067AX-20Chr1_419087141908741TC0130.067我想使用sort命令根据第4列对文件进行排序。我在互联网上到处查找,发现修女有效的不同解决方案!我什至在stackoverflow中发现了类似的问题,但答案对我不起作用!所以这些是我正在使用但不起作用的命令!sort-n-k4,1out1.txtsort-n-k4out1.txtsort-n-k4out1.txtsort-nk4out1.txts

linux - 如何使用 Linux 命令 Sort 根据第 4 列,数字顺序对文本文件进行排序?

我有一个这样的文件(以空格分隔):AX-18Chr1_419085141908545TC-1980.51AX-19Chr1_419087141908740TC0150.067AX-20Chr1_419087141908741TC0130.067我想使用sort命令根据第4列对文件进行排序。我在互联网上到处查找,发现修女有效的不同解决方案!我什至在stackoverflow中发现了类似的问题,但答案对我不起作用!所以这些是我正在使用但不起作用的命令!sort-n-k4,1out1.txtsort-n-k4out1.txtsort-n-k4out1.txtsort-nk4out1.txts

PHP Postgres : Get Last Insert ID

我发现了几个关于这个主题的其他问题。这个……mysql_insert_idalternativeforpostgresql...和themanual似乎表明您可以随时调用lastval(),它将按预期工作。但是这个……PostgresqlandPHP:isthecurrvalaefficentwaytoretrievethelastrowinsertedid,inamultiuserapplication?...似乎说明它必须在交易中。所以我的问题是:在查询lastval()(没有事务)之前,我可以等多久就等多久?面对许多并发连接,这是否可靠? 最佳答案

PHP Postgres : Get Last Insert ID

我发现了几个关于这个主题的其他问题。这个……mysql_insert_idalternativeforpostgresql...和themanual似乎表明您可以随时调用lastval(),它将按预期工作。但是这个……PostgresqlandPHP:isthecurrvalaefficentwaytoretrievethelastrowinsertedid,inamultiuserapplication?...似乎说明它必须在交易中。所以我的问题是:在查询lastval()(没有事务)之前,我可以等多久就等多久?面对许多并发连接,这是否可靠? 最佳答案

php - mysql_insert_id 替代 postgresql

是否有用于PostgreSQL的mysql_insert_id()php函数的替代方案?大多数框架通过查找ID中使用的序列的当前值来部分解决问题。但是,有时主键不是串行列.... 最佳答案 从PostgreSQL的角度来看,在伪代码中:*$insert_id=INSERT...RETURNINGfoo_id;--onlyworksforPostgreSQL>=8.2.*INSERT...;$insert_id=SELECTlastval();--worksforPostgreSQL>=8.1*$insert_id=SELECTnex

php - mysql_insert_id 替代 postgresql

是否有用于PostgreSQL的mysql_insert_id()php函数的替代方案?大多数框架通过查找ID中使用的序列的当前值来部分解决问题。但是,有时主键不是串行列.... 最佳答案 从PostgreSQL的角度来看,在伪代码中:*$insert_id=INSERT...RETURNINGfoo_id;--onlyworksforPostgreSQL>=8.2.*INSERT...;$insert_id=SELECTlastval();--worksforPostgreSQL>=8.1*$insert_id=SELECTnex

spring Boot接口映射文件中insert标签中的主键自增属性是什么?接口映射文件中如何开启主键自增?

·insert标签中的id="insert"的意思是指定该语句映射的接口中的具体方法名称,insert是接口中的方法名;·useGeneratedKeys="true"是开启主键自增;解释为什么要开启这个功能,数据库表中id这个属性设置为了主键自增,而mybatis并不会自动进行初始化,不会自动插入,所以需要我们在这里开启一下主键自增,自增的条件设置是keyProperty;·keyProperty="uid"是指定表中的哪个主键作为自增的条件,这里指定了uid作为自增条件;-->useGeneratedKeys="true"keyProperty="uid">   INSERTINTOt_u